First point to work outside, is whether your opponent is playing with zone or man coverage. As suggested by the name, man coverage is a in which a defender has the direct responsibility for an offensive player. This can open up game ups for?? Prominent offensive players, especially ones with good pace, route running, and release.Zone coverage will protect parts of the area, and as recipients move across their zonesthey will cover them before passing onto the next zone. These defenses demand a QB to pick holes in the zones and time cries in between them.
One fast method to recognize this, is to ship a participant in movement on crime. Press B/O till you get a receiver and press left or right to move them. In the event the player reverse on defense moves, this reveals man, if they don't -- it is likely zone. Although see later, the very best players may conceal these things.The largest cues to a defensive coverage comes in the safeties. How many there are on the area, and in which they stand, can provide a QB clues what drama is coming from them. ? As you dig more into defensive coverages?, you will begin to find the following terms;This really is a guy coverage scheme which leaves the 1 safety in a zone in the middle of the area. You can take a guy cover two or a zone cover 2, making it tricky to see which policy it's until after the snap.
This is a zone coverage scheme and leaves 3 defensive backs (normally 1 safety and 2 cornerbacks) across the area defending a pass. This can be a zone policy and leaves the two cornerbacks and safeties in deep zones defending the pass. The more the defense anticipates a deep pass, the more deep zones they will use, and you will see more players off the line off scrimmage and immediately dropping off using the snap of their ball.Based on trying to figure out if it is a man or a zone defense, after that you can attempt to guess that the cover and then use certain plays to take advantage of the.
If you believe it to be a Cover 2 man defense because it's possible to see 2 safeties packed with each receiver covered up then that opens up the idea of drag or slant routes which are shorter, the departure plays that generate changes of instructions to get open but without denying those zones.If you believe it to be a Cover 1 Man shield because you can view 1 security in the middle of the area. This opens up the concept of outside routes and plays, in which you have to beat at 1 person, but the surfaces of the area are now opened up.
